Essential Fishing Gear for Lake of Menteith
Before you head out to Lake of Menteith, it's crucial to ensure you have the right gear for the job. Here's a checklist of essential items:
- Fishing Rod and Reel: A versatile rod and reel combo suitable for trout fishing is ideal. Consider a 9-foot, 5- or 6-weight rod for fly fishing, or a spinning rod for lure fishing.
 - Fishing Line: Choose a high-quality fishing line with appropriate strength and visibility for the conditions. Fluorocarbon or monofilament lines are popular choices.
 - Flies and Lures: Carry a selection of flies and lures that are known to work well on Lake of Menteith. Popular choices include Kate McLaren, Black Pennell, and various nymph patterns. For lures, consider spinners, spoons, and small crankbaits.
 - Waders or Waterproof Boots: Depending on the fishing location and weather conditions, waders or waterproof boots may be necessary to stay dry and comfortable.
 - Fishing Vest or Backpack: A fishing vest or backpack is essential for carrying your gear, including flies, lures, line, tools, and snacks.
 - Polarized Sunglasses: Polarized sunglasses reduce glare and improve visibility, allowing you to spot fish and underwater structures more easily.
 - Hat and Sunscreen: Protect yourself from the sun with a hat and sunscreen, even on cloudy days.
 - Rain Gear: Be prepared for unpredictable weather by bringing rain gear, such as a waterproof jacket and pants.
 - First Aid Kit: A small first aid kit is essential for treating minor injuries, such as cuts and scrapes.
 - Fishing License: Make sure you have a valid fishing license for Scotland before heading out to the lake.
 
Lake of Menteith: A Fishing Paradise
The Lake of Menteith is renowned as one of Scotland's premier fishing destinations, offering anglers the chance to catch wild brown trout and stocked rainbow trout in a breathtaking setting.
